Off-Price Retailer to Join List of Anchors at 336,000SF Clermont Landing
July 25, 2008

Ross Dress for Less has signed a lease to occupy one of the anchor positions at Clermont Landing, a 366,000-square-foot in Clermont, Fla., at the intersection of Route 27 and Route 50, about 20 miles west of Orlando. Represented by The Shopping Center Group, the discount retailer signed a lease with property developer Weingarten Realty to occupy 30,200 square feet at the shopping center, which is scheduled to open its doors in March 2009. JC Penney, T.J. Maxx and Michaels will also serve as anchors, flanked by additional national retailers and lifestyle tenants.
